I like makeup and given the chance, I prefer to wear it, however, sometimes I worry that makeup becomes a necessity to us (me included), rather than an accessory. It's sad, but I hear girls and women all the time saying they won't leave the house without makeup. I say we remember that we wear makeup for ourselves, not for others. If we're putting on makeup to change the way others see us, we're wearing it wrong. Let's give ourselves a break and leave the house every once in a while wearing little or no makeup! The only ones who can stop us are ourselves.
